JEE Mains score is required to get into the college of your choice to pursue the B.Tech Degree. However, for admissions into IITs/NITs/GFTIs it is necessary to have min. 75% in Class 12 th Board Examination (GEN Category) and 65% if you are a SC/ST Candidate.
